Where is the Ichten family from?

You can see how Ichten families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Ichten family name was found in the USA in 1880. In 1880 there was 1 Ichten family living in Minnesota. This was 100% of all the recorded Ichten's in USA. Minnesota had the highest population of Ichten families in 1880.
